Output daf694593096c553fffcc215c1f039005f3395992aeed92eea5ca3f3eae0f32b:10

value
817480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b65557f538048f3e0e430386e28c98371ee434 OP_EQUAL
address
3QTNc47HUEmfSq1fcrGfviR9bHNouX6wy9
transaction
daf694593096c553fffcc215c1f039005f3395992aeed92eea5ca3f3eae0f32b
confirmations
376238
spent
true